Bank Clerk Job Responsibilities:


When you start to find out the job responsibilities of a bank probationary officer (PO) and that of a bank clerk, you often get a little bit confused over the differences between a bank PO and a bank clerk. Therefore, it is very important to know about both, as there are separate exams for each post.

Bank clerks find their utilization in all sectors of business of lending money. Their primary duties involve:
  1. Acquiring / attracting new customers.
  2. Properly counselling the existing customers.
  3. Selling banking services.
  4. Promoting standardized products and services.
Besides this, they may be engaged in different specialized areas like:
  1. Data processing 
  2. Personnel management 
  3. Internal auditing 
  4. Controlling 
  5. Organizing 
  6. Marketing
It takes almost 3 years to reach bank PO post after becoming a bank clerk. The initial basic salary for a bank clerk is around 8000 INR per month.

Bank PO Job Responsibilities


A bank probationary officer (PO) is the entry-level position for the bank officers. Their traditional task includes:
  1. Administration work
  2. General banking work
  3. They also respond to the complaints of the customers related to issues like charges, account discrepancies or even the bank services. 
After the successful completion of the probationary period I. E. of 2 years, the bank PO now becomes the assistant manager. In the starting, they are placed in the areas that look after customer transactions. However, once they become experienced, they are given an opportunity to work in other areas like:
  1. Marketing
  2. Planning
  3. Budgeting
  4. Processing of loans and investment management etc.
A bank PO has much more authority and influence than a bank clerk does. The initial 'basic salary' of a bank probationary officer is around 15000 INR per month along with several other benefits and perks.
